WebPahoehoe lava flows develop surface crusts thatform thick plates with ropy and/or gently undulating surfaces. What Types of Lava Flows Are There Underwater? Lava erupting on the deep sea floor has a form most like pahoehoe flows. Threetypes of lava flows are common on the sea floor: pillow lava, lobate lava, andsheet lava.
